### India's Retail Inflation Plummets to Historic Low of 0.25% in October 2025 India's retail inflation has reached a record low of **0.25%** in October 2025, marking a significant decline from **0.54%** in September. This unprecedented drop is attributed to a combination of factors, including substantial cuts in Goods and Services Tax (GST) rates and a notable decrease in food prices, particularly vegetables and fruits. The current inflation rate is the lowest recorded since the introduction of the Consumer Price Index (CPI) series in 2012, providing a potential boost for consumers and policymakers alike. However, experts caution that this trend may be temporary, and core inflation has seen a slight uptick, indicating underlying price pressures may still exist [https://www.5paisa.com/news/indias-retail-inflation-hits-record-low-of-025-in-october-driven-by-food-price-drops-and-gst][https://www.rediff.com/business/report/retail-inflation-down-to-multi-year-low-of-025-in-oct/20251112.htm]. ### Key Factors Behind the Decline in Retail Inflation 1. **GST Rate Cuts**: The reduction in GST rates has played a crucial role in lowering the overall inflation rate, impacting various sectors positively [https://www.timesnownews.com/business-economy/economy/retail-inflation-cools-to-a-record-low-of-0-25-in-october-article-153139901]. 2. **Food Price Declines**: A significant drop in food prices, especially for vegetables and fruits, has been a major contributor to the inflation decrease. Reports indicate that prices for some essential items have fallen dramatically, with vegetables becoming up to **51%** cheaper [https://www.newindianexpress.com/business/2025/Nov/12/indias-inflation-cools-to-decade-low-as-food-prices-fall-gst-cuts-take-effect][https://www.bhaskarenglish.in/business/news/retail-inflation-may-fall-below-1-per-cent-vegetables-pulses-rice-become-cheaper-by-up-to-51-per-cent-136390874.html]. 3. **Favorable Base Effect**: The comparison to previous months, particularly September's inflation rate, has created a favorable base effect, further contributing to the low inflation figure [https://www.outlookbusiness.com/news/retail-inflation-falls-to-multi-year-low-of-025-in-october-strengthens-hopes-for-rbi-rate-cut-in-december]. 4. **Core Inflation Trends**: While overall inflation has decreased, core inflation has seen a slight increase, suggesting that not all sectors are experiencing the same relief from price pressures [https://www.fortuneindia.com/economy/retail-inflation-hits-record-low-of-025-in-october/128098]. ### Supporting Data and Evidence - **Inflation Rates**: - October 2025: **0.25%** - September 2025: **0.54%** - August 2025: **1.44%** [https://www.businessupturn.com/finance/economy/indias-cpi-inflation-drops-to-record-low-of-0-25-in-october-2025-vs-1-54-in-september]. - **Price Changes for Essential Items**: - Vegetables: **51%** cheaper - Pulses: **29%** cheaper - Rice: **1.2%** cheaper [https://www.bhaskarenglish.in/business/news/retail-inflation-may-fall-below-1-per-cent-vegetables-pulses-rice-become-cheaper-by-up-to-51-per-cent-136390874.html]. ### Conclusion: Implications of Low Retail Inflation The record low retail inflation of **0.25%** in October 2025 presents a unique opportunity for economic growth and consumer relief. 1. **Potential for RBI Rate Cuts**: The low inflation rate strengthens the case for the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) to consider interest rate cuts in December, which could further stimulate economic activity [https://www.outlookbusiness.com/news/retail-inflation-falls-to-multi-year-low-of-025-in-october-strengthens-hopes-for-rbi-rate-cut-in-december]. 2. **Consumer Benefits**: Consumers are likely to benefit from lower prices, enhancing purchasing power and potentially boosting spending in the economy [https://www.dnpindia.in/nation/retail-inflation-drops-to-record-low-of-0-25-in-october-as-food-prices-fall/573690]. 3. **Caution on Sustainability**: Despite the positive outlook, experts warn that the current trend may not be sustainable in the long term, and vigilance is required to monitor core inflation trends [https://www.newindianexpress.com/business/2025/Nov/12/indias-inflation-cools-to-decade-low-as-food-prices-fall-gst-cuts-take-effect].
